Why Worcester Homes Need a Local Garage Door Specialist

Worcester's housing landscape runs the full spectrum. You've got century-old triple-deckers near Main South, postwar ranches throughout Tatnuck and Burncoat, and newer construction in areas like Green Hill. Each style comes with its own garage door challenges. Older homes often have undersized or oddly configured garage spaces that need custom solutions, while newer builds might have builder-grade doors that fail faster than expected.

The weather here doesn't do garage doors any favors either. Worcester sits at a higher elevation than much of Eastern Massachusetts, which means you get hit harder by winter storms and temperature swings. Those freeze-thaw cycles are brutal on metal components. Springs lose tension faster, rollers crack, and weather stripping fails earlier than it would closer to the coast.

We see common patterns across Worcester neighborhoods. Broken torsion springs top the list, usually failing after 7 to 9 years rather than the 10 that manufacturers claim. Opener issues spike during winter when cold temperatures affect the motor and drive mechanisms. Cable fraying happens more in homes where the door isn't properly balanced, putting extra strain on the lifting system.

What We Do for Worcester Homeowners

Our most frequent service call is spring replacement, and for good reason. When a torsion spring breaks, your door becomes a 150-pound paperweight. We stock commercial-grade springs on every truck and can replace both springs (we always recommend doing both even if only one broke) in about an hour for most standard doors.

Opener installation is another specialty. We install LiftMaster, Chamberlain, and Genie models, and we'll walk you through which one makes sense for your situation. A basic chain drive works fine for a detached garage, but if your bedroom sits above the garage, a belt drive system keeps things quieter. We handle the full installation including programming remotes, setting up smartphone controls, and making sure all safety sensors align perfectly.

Cable and roller repairs keep doors running smoothly. Frayed cables need immediate attention because a snapped cable can cause the door to fall unevenly, damaging panels or worse. Worn rollers create that grinding, scraping sound nobody wants to hear at 6 a.m. We replace them with nylon rollers that last longer and run quieter than the steel ones that came with most builder installations.

Full door replacement becomes necessary when panels are dented beyond repair, the door is decades old and no longer insulated properly, or you simply want to upgrade your home's curb appeal. We source insulated steel doors, carriage house styles, and modern aluminum-and-glass designs depending on what fits your home and budget.

Maintenance plans make sense for Worcester homeowners who want to avoid emergency calls. Twice-yearly service includes spring tension adjustment, roller lubrication, safety sensor testing, and opener inspection. What does a typical garage door repair cost in Worcester?

Spring replacement usually runs $225 to $350 for a standard two-car garage door depending on spring size and door weight. Opener installation ranges from $350 to $550 depending on the model and whether you need additional accessories. Cable replacement costs $150 to $200 per cable.
